Transaction 59f401fdacbd6552bd08a1aae586a61e48fe0763b11de587362963add33e2596
1 Input
1 Output
-
59f401fdacbd6552bd08a1aae586a61e48fe0763b11de587362963add33e2596:0
- value
- 4643127
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d62d8d28199a70f2e6683869bc5c74a06d1671b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FMBW8EWQKuBqqD7AVcuiHSRg8oWti9GE6